WESLEY ON SINGING
Have an eye to God in every word you sing. Aim at pleasing God more than yourself, or any other creature. In order to do this attend strictly to the sense of what you sing, and see that your heart is not carried away with the sound, but offered to god continually; so shall your singing be such as the Lord will approve here, and reward you when he cometh in the in the clouds of heaven. John Wesley, Rules for Singing (1761), Rule 7, as reported in Alive Now, Jul
Aug 1987, page 7.
